Offchain Logic Execution

Logic

Offchain Logic Execution represents a paradigm shift in how computational processes are handled within blockchain ecosystems and derivative markets, moving beyond the limitations of on-chain execution. It involves performing complex calculations, validations, and business rules outside the primary blockchain, subsequently submitting only the verified results or state changes to the chain. This approach enhances scalability, reduces transaction costs, and enables the implementation of sophisticated financial instruments, such as complex options strategies and structured products, that would be impractical or prohibitively expensive to execute entirely on-chain. The core benefit lies in decoupling computationally intensive operations from the consensus mechanism, improving overall system efficiency.
